SINGAPORE - The Singapore Golf Association (SGA) has welcomed news that Keppel Club has been offered the opportunity to operate Singapore Island Country Club's (SICC) Sime Course as a hybrid members-public facility.
This potential move, which is being negotiated between both clubs, is important to ensure the game remains accessible to the masses and also develop a pipeline of budding talent, noted SGA general manager Jerome Ng.
